The ventive is an -a or -(an)ni(m) morpheme that is typically attached to verbs of movement, but it may have a lexicalized meaning and appear in any finite verb. The ventive marks the direction of a situation. Currently feature takes yes/no values although RIAO data and much of MCONG data uses unary value (yes).
